I was working on a project about compost, and came across this wonderful documentary named: "Back to Eden".
In our World today, we often complicate things.
Our nature is amazing, and we could learn a lot just by watching, and copy what it does.
Paul Gautschi, the gardener in the film, refer a lot to the Bible and God, but the science of this gardening method will fascinate you, religious or not.
